Overview
Definition

Senile Lentigo or age spots are small dark spots or freckles on the skin which occur as you age. They appear on sun exposed areas, like the face and neck and the backs of the hands. It is common after the age of 50 but they can be faded, to make the skin more even in colour, with a bespoke regime of medicated creams.
Symptoms

Dark spots on the skin of sun exposed areas, like the face and neck and the backs of the hands. These are common after the age of 50.
Causes

These are common after the age of 50, and are caused by sun exposure. They can occur prematurely due to extensive sun exposure. They are more common in people with light skin colour.
